Day 17 (11 Mar 2020) – A place to belong

1) Ephesians 2:19 (TLB); 2) 1 Timothy 3:15b (GWT)

1) Now you are no longer strangers to God and foreigners to heaven, but you are members of God’s very own family, citizens of God’s country, and you belong in God’s household with every other Christian. 2) God’s family is the church of the living God, the pillar and foundation of the truth.

I love that the Bible tells us, quite plainly, that we are part of God’s family. The experience of healthy family on earth is such a rich experience. Of course, none of our earthly families are perfect, and nor are our experiences in them.

But when I think of my own family, I think of experiences of being loved quite unconditionally, of being accepted in all sorts of different states of mind, and helped practically and faithfully. That God would want us to know that being in His family is like this, with Him as our Father, is incredible to ponder. With our Heavenly Father as head of this family, He makes us fit to belong in His family and helps us learn the habits of heart and life that cause us to belong more comfortably ourselves and create belonging for everyone else.

Heavenly Father, thank you for the rich metaphor you use to describe your church – the family of God. I thank you that as we grow healthy as your family, we are increasingly a place of unconditional love, incredible acceptance, and help that is practical and faithful in all aspects of life. Help each one of us in this your family grow in this grace and grow in this lifestyle towards each other, in Jesus name, Amen.
